If you want to bring your spouse to the U.S. to live and work together, you need to know which category you fall under. There are two main categories:
CR-1: For couples where one spouse is a U.S. citizen and the marriage has lasted less than 2 years. The requirement of this visa is that both spouses must live together in the U.S. for at least 2 years after entry.
IR-1: For couples where one spouse is a U.S. citizen and the marriage has lasted more than 2 years. Under this category, you are eligible for permanent residency immediately after entering the U.S.

The processing time for a spousal sponsorship application depends on each couple’s specific case. If the sponsor is a U.S. citizen, the application usually takes around 10–14 months to process. However, if the sponsor is only a lawful permanent resident with a green card, the waiting time may range from 12–20 months.
The visa applicant must prepare a number of documents as required by the U.S. government, including:
Form I-130, Petition for Alien Relative, fully completed and signed.
A copy of the marriage certificate for verification.
A copy of the divorce decree if there was a previous marriage.
Passport-style photos of both spouses with a white background.
Proof of any legal name change, if applicable.
Evidence that the sponsor is a U.S. citizen, such as a naturalization certificate, birth certificate, or copy of a U.S. passport,...
If you want to expedite the process, it is important to know the required steps in advance. Applying for a spousal visa generally includes the following basic steps:
File Form I-130 with the U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) to petition for your spouse’s immigrant visa. Make sure the form is complete and signed before submission.
After submitting the petition, you must pay the required fees before your case is processed at the National Visa Center (NVC). The applicant will also need to provide an affidavit of support as required by U.S. authorities.

After receiving the appointment letter, you are required to undergo a medical examination and receive the necessary vaccinations as mandated by the U.S. government. Once completed, you must bring the medical records to present at the interview.
You must attend your interview on the date scheduled by the National Visa Center (NVC). When going to the U.S. Embassy or Consulate for the interview, dress appropriately and bring all required documents.
If your interview is successful, you will be granted an immigrant visa. Note that this visa only allows you to enter the United States; whether or not you can obtain permanent residency will depend on the post-entry conditions.
If everything goes smoothly, you will be issued a green card about 2–3 months after entering the U.S. in the spousal sponsorship category. In some cases, the process may take longer, and certain applications may even be denied depending on the documentation provided.
Yes, you can sponsor your spouse without being a U.S. citizen, but you must hold a green card as a lawful permanent resident. The required paperwork is generally not much different from cases where the sponsor is a U.S. citizen.
The U.S. government allows its citizens to petition for a foreign fiancé(e) to enter the country. However, since there is no legal marital bond, the process is more complex and the success rate is lower compared to spousal sponsorship.
